Common Kitchen Drywall Installation Jobs
Kitchen drywall installation involves preparing walls for a smooth, durable surface in cooking and prep areas.
Drywall hanging provides a seamless background for kitchen paint or tile finishes.
Moisture-resistant drywall is recommended for areas prone to humidity and splashes.
Soundproof drywall can help reduce noise between the kitchen and adjacent rooms.
Textured drywall offers decorative options to match kitchen design styles.
Drywall finishing includes taping, sanding, and priming for a polished look.
Kitchen Drywall Installation Questions
What types of drywall are used in kitchen installations? Standard drywall is common, but moisture-resistant or mold-resistant drywall is often preferred for kitchens to handle humidity and spills.
How is drywall installed in a kitchen? Drywall is hung on wall framing, taped, and finished with joint compound to create a smooth surface suitable for painting or tiling.
Are there special considerations for kitchen drywall? Yes, moisture management and durability are important, so materials and finishing techniques are chosen to withstand kitchen conditions.
Can drywall be installed around cabinets and fixtures? Yes, drywall can be cut and fitted around cabinets, appliances, and fixtures to provide a seamless finish in the kitchen space.
